Zimbabwean activist and Zanu-PF member Malcom “Traore” Masarira was arrested in Harare after allegedly being trapped with $10,000. Authorities charged him with inciting violence and undermining the government. Masarira, known for his “Chiwenga for President” campaign, has been critical of President Emmerson Mnangagwa and efforts to extend his rule to 2030. His arrest underscores rising political tensions and factional battles within Zanu-PF between Mnangagwa and Vice President Constantino Chiwenga.
